North-East Development Commission

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The North-East Development Commission (NEDC) is a commission in Nigeria established to rebuild infrastructure and institutions destroyed by Boko Haram in northeast Nigeria.[1] The commission oversees activities in Borno, Adamawa, Bauchi, Taraba, Gombe and Yobe states.[2]

The NED has promoted development in Nigeria by donating bulletproof vests and helmets to the Agro Rangers.[3]
